So Knightmare dropped his phantom this morning. The reason I'm mentioning it here instead of his thread is that there's a massive amount of overlap between his phantom and Twomey's. They have the following picks in common:

1 – Western Bulldogs (matching Adelaide's bid) – Jamarra Ugle-Hagan
2 – Adelaide – Riley Thilthorpe
3 – North Melbourne – Elijah Hollands
4 – Sydney – Denver Grainger-Barras
5 – Hawthorn – Logan McDonald
6 – Gold Coast – Will Phillips
8 – Essendon – Zach Reid
9 – Sydney (matching Essendon's bid) – Braeden Campbell
10 – Essendon – Oliver Henry
11 – Adelaide – Reef McInnes
12 – Greater Western Sydney – Heath Chapman
13 –North Melbourne – Tom Powell
14 – Fremantle – Brayden Cook
15 – Greater Western Sydney – Nik Cox
16 – Collingwood – Archie Perkins
17 – Port Adelaide (matching Greater Western Sydney's bid) – Lachie Jones
19 – Collingwood – Conor Stone
21 – Melbourne – Jack Carroll
22 – Sydney (Matching Melbourne's bid) – Errol Gulden
23 – Melbourne – Max Holmes

Although KM has Cox and Chapman flipped but still going to GWS, and Gulden being bid on with 21.

The only big difference between them is that Twomey has Bruhn to Essendon at 7 with Macrae dropping to the late teens, and KM has it the other way around.
